1.7 Deposits. Manager will collect and hold all security deposits in compliance
with Oklahoma law. Any pet deposits will be non-refundable and will be
charged as additional rent payable to Owner.
1.8 Reports. Manager will provide log-in information that will allow Owner to
generate financial statements and reports at any time. Manager will also
provide such reports promptly upon request.
2. Fees.
2.1 Rent Fee. Owner agrees to pay to Manager a fee equal to eight percent (8%)
of all rent collected (up to $150 per unit, per month).
2.2 Placement Fee. Upon the placement of each new tenant, Owner will pay
Manager a fee of $200. However, Owner will not be required to pay more
than one placement fee per unit, per calendar year.
2.3 Application Fee. Manager is authorized to charge a reasonable application fee
to all prospective tenant applicants. Manager will retain all application fees.
3. Lease Provisions. Tenant leases will contain the following provisions, unless Owner
directs otherwise (in writing):
1 year term (minimum);
Electronic rent deposits are considered received when paid;
Tenant responsible for lawn care;
Owner to treat for pests (insects/rodents) within 30 days
after move-in, tenant is responsible after 30 days;
Owners can specify a preferred pet policy on Exhibit A.
Manager’s default policy says dogs, cats and small pets are
permitted with $250 pet deposit, except that large dogs and
dangerous breeds are not permitted, other animals subject
to approval;
